Description

(-)-Mitorubrinic Acid CAS NO 58958-07-9 is a specific enantiomer of the natural azaphilone pigment mitorubrinic acid, known for its distinct biological and chemical properties. This compound is of significant interest in advanced research and development due to its role as a key chiral intermediate and its potential bioactivity. It is primarily utilized by researchers and manufacturers in the pharmaceutical, biotechnology, and fine chemical synthesis sectors for applications ranging from novel drug discovery to the development of specialized analytical standards.

Basic Information

Product Name (-)-Mitorubrinic Acid
CAS No. 58958-07-9
Molecular Formula C14H12O6
Molecular Weight 276.24 g/mol
Synonyms (-)-Mitorubrinic acid; (R)-Mitorubrinic acid; L-Mitorubrinic acid; (R)-3,5-Dimethyl-8-hydroxy-6-methoxy-7-methyl-1H-2-benzopyran-1,4(3H)-dione; Azaphilone pigment derivative; Monomeric mitorubrinic acid enantiomer
